    Krishna District with its district headquarters at Machilipatnam is the coastal district of Andhra Pradesh. It was formerly called as Machilipatnam District.     The famous river Krishna is flowing in this district. Krishna being a great and sacred river of South Indian likes Godavari and Kavery. The Major Stream is Budameru flowing in this District.

    Tropical Climate conditions with extreme hot summer and cold winter prevail in this district. April to June is the hottest months with high temperature in May. The monsoon usually breaks in the middle of June and brings good rains up to middle of October. The normal rainfall of this district is 1047.68 M.M, 2/3rds of which is received through the S...

    Three types of soils viz., 1. Black soil which constitute 57.6% of the villages 2. Sandy Clayloams with 22.3% and 3. Red loamy with 19.4% of the villages are prevalent in this district, while a small sandy soils constitute 0.7% fringes on the sea coast.

    Endowed with a rich variety of soils, the district occupies an important place in Agriculture which is the most important occupation and paddy is the main food crop produced. While 2019-20 the gross cropped area of the district was 3.76 Lakh Hects of which gross irrigated area was 2.42 lakh Hects.

    The District is well served by Roads and Railways. 502 villages (including some of the major hamlets) have been connected with transport facilities Gudivada is the Major Railway Junction in the District and Machilipatnam is the Major Station in the District. District has an aerodrome at Gannavaram. A minor sea port is at Machilipatnam.

    Krishna District has recorded a literacy of 10.52 as per 2011 census. This district is much advanced in the field of education. Almost all the villages in the district are having primary schools. NTR Medical University is located at Vijayawada.

  3. 5 days ago · District Profile. GENERAL. Krishna district was one of the oldest British administrated areas of Andhra Pradesh. It was formerly called Masulapatnam district and in 1859 when the then Guntur district was abolished, certain taluks thereof were added to this district which was renamed as Krishna district, after the mighty river Krishna.
